单项选择题

A.将抽象部分与它的实现部分分离,使它们都可以独立变化
B.给定一个语言,定义它的文法的一种表示,并定义一个解释器,这个解释器使用该表示来解释语言中的句子
C.将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示
D.为其他对象提供一种代理以控制对这个对象的访问

相关考题

单项选择题 以下意图()可用来描述中介者(Mediator)。

单项选择题 关于模式适用性,()不适合使用职责链(Chain of Responsibility)模式。

单项选择题 关于模式适用性,以下()不适合使用模板方法(Template Method)模式。

单项选择题 以下意图()可用来描述命令(Command)模式。

单项选择题 关于模式适用性,以下()适合使用组合(Composite)模式。

单项选择题 如果有一个2MB 的文本(英文字母),为了对其中的字母进行分类和计数,若为文本中的每个字母都定义一个对象显然不合实际,对与该问题最好可使用的模式是()。

单项选择题 关于模式适用性,以下()不适合使用Flyweight(享元)模式。

单项选择题 以下()用来描述工厂方法(Factory Method)模式。

单项选择题 以下()用来描述建造者(Builder )。

单项选择题 对以下开闭原则的描述错误的是()

问答题 说明访问者模式的定义与主要优缺点。

问答题 创建型模式分包括哪几种设计模式,各是什么并简要说明。

问答题 设计模式一般有哪几个基本要素?

名词解释 单一职责原则

判断题 Template Method是用以帮助从不同的步骤中抽象出一个通用的过程的模式。

判断题 通过在问题领域中使用模式,可以用一种不同的方式来看待问题。

判断题 对观察者模式,触发事件的对象——Subject对象不需要知道观察事件的所有对象。

判断题 Singleton(单例)模式属于结构性模式。

判断题 对象适配器模式是依赖倒转原则的典型应用。

填空题 Word 2010单击()菜单,选择“页眉和页脚”命令。